CTX-439 is an orally active, ATP-competitive small-molecule inhibitor of CDK12 and CDK13 , with an IC 50 of 3.1 nM and a K d of 0.38 nM against CDK12 , and an IC 50 of 9.2 nM against CDK13 . CTX-439 induces DNA damage and apoptosis in tumor cells. CTX-439 is applicable for the research of breast cancer and ovarian cancer .
